WebAs the winners of an international design competition along with Entuitive and Grimshaw, sbp has designed six bridges to serve as connections to the new Port Lands development. The bridges are a key infrastructure component of this large-scale revitalization of Toronto’s waterfront. Formerly an industrial site, the Port Lands project provides the city with new ...
